ThyneAlone wrote:Yes, that's what I gathered too. September 25th. Goodness knows when the UK will get it, though!
Small question to US members - why is Friday such a graveyard slot?
Hey! I'm not a US member, but I thought I'd take a run at this one. It has been said that when a show moves from its regular slot into a Friday slot, it's been sent there "to die". I think this is somewhat based on shows on the past, that have been moved to Friday and then have been canceled. Dark Angel is the only one I can think of off the top of my head. It did well in its first season, but then moved to Friday and flopped.

I'm not sure the exact reasoning ... my theory is that perhaps because it's a Friday night, and the first official night of the weekend - most people aren't home to watch TV. However, if it was still a show I enjoyed, I would be setting my tape if I weren't home (as I did with Dark Angel).

Those are my ideas, but perhaps the other US viewers know more?

ThyneAlone wrote:This makes sense, of course, but I feel it's much less true here, and I was wondering whether there were cultural differences that made it more so. If we're at a point where shows can be recorded, I don't see the issue. In the UK, high-profile shows have often been shown, and been popular, on a Friday, without coming to grief, but boards populated mainly by t'other side of the pond inhabitants appear to become very concerned at the mere mention of Friday. Does it 'matter' more in the US which night shows air?
I think now Fridays and Saturday nights are "deadly" nights for TV shows, because of other things people do. Saturdays used to be very popular (of course, I'm basing that off watching The Golden Girls back in the day with my mom), but now a lot of stations show reruns or specials. Or Dateline's To Catch A Predator. Sunday nights are also show killers. For me, it's hard because I have class two nights a week and I don't know when they'll be until I register for them, so this semester I won't be able to see anything on Wednesdays or Thursdays, which means I'll miss Ramsey's Kitchen Nightmares (we've finally stolen him from you..woo hoo!) on Wednesdays and CSI on Thursdays. But I was THRILLED that Bones moved to Tuesdays, because now I won't miss any episodes. BUT, it's moving to Fridays in January when American Idol pops back up. So then it will conflict with Meerkat Manor, but they rerun the Meerkat show constantly, so I'm not worried about that.

So, other then telling you all my own personal TV viewing schedule, I guess I'm just saying that Yes, days do matter over here. When Friends was on and we had Must See TV Thursday, NO ONE missed Thursday nights. We'd watch and then go party, or make sure there was a TV where we partied. Plus now you have "those shows" that you don't really want to go up against because they are so popular (like CSI, although it may have jumped the shark with the way they ended last season). Oh yes, then we have Sunday Night Football, Monday Night Football, and the World Series to contend with in the Fall. Although I'm not complaining about the football.
